A1 Teams Switzerland and Ireland Win at A1GP Sepang, Malaysia
Neel Jani became the fifth different race winner this season as A1 Team Switzerland took victory in the Sprint race at the Sepang International Circuit. France's Loïc Duval finished second ahead of Earl Bamber for A1 Team New Zealand in third. A1 Team Ireland became the first nation to score two victories this season, as Adam Carroll dominated the Sepang Feature race to take a comfortable win. Filipe Albuquerque raced to second place for Portugal while Marco Andretti finished third for the USA.
